Rheostat Resistor Control. When placed into an electrical circuit, a rheostat can be used to adjust and control the amount of current flowing around it. A rheostat, also known as a variable resistor, is an electrical component used to regulate the flow of current in a circuit. A rheostat is a variable resistor that controls the current or voltage in a circuit by adjusting its resistance.
